Discover the extraordinary life and career of Daniel Radcliffe, the British actor who captured the world's imagination as Harry Potter and went on to forge one of the most compelling post-child-star careers in entertainment history. Born on July 23, 1989, in Fulham, London, Daniel Jacob Radcliffe showed a passion for acting from a young age, landing his first role as young David Copperfield in a 1999 BBC adaptation before being cast in the role of a lifetime at just 11 years old. This podcast delivers a comprehensive Daniel Radcliffe biography, tracing his journey from his early London childhood and surprise casting by producer David Heyman through all eight Harry Potter films that became the second-highest-grossing franchise in cinema history. Explore how Radcliffe boldly challenged expectations with his acclaimed West End and Broadway stage work, including his breakout turn in Equus and his starring role in How to Succeed in Business Without Really Trying. Follow his deliberate and successful transition into indie films like The Woman in Black and Kill Your Darlings, his television work on Miracle Workers alongside Steve Buscemi, and his continued evolution as a versatile and respected actor well beyond the wizarding world.     Daniel Radcliffe, the eternal boy wizard turned Broadway powerhouse, has been making waves in the last few days with a deeply personal spotlight on his transformation from youthful struggles to fatherhood bliss. On April 3, BroadwayWorld reports he hosted a riveting post-show talkback on mental health after his performance in Every Brilliant Thing at New Yorks Hudson Theatre, chatting with Project Healthy Minds CEO Phillip Schermer in front of an engaged crowd. Photos from the event capture Radcliffe looking sharp and reflective, diving into topics that hit close to home. CinemaBlend and KROC news echo the buzz from that panel, where the 36-year-old actor opened up about his profoundly unhappy 20s plagued by alcohol issues and heavy smoking for two decades. He revealed how his three-year-old son with partner Erin Darke flipped the script, sparking intrusive thoughts about his own mortality that prompted him to quit smoking cold turkey right after the birth. His younger self, he said, wouldnt recognize this joyful dad strolling hand-in-hand with his silly, gorgeous kid, embracing healthier choices and profound happiness. Just yesterday, March 13, Theatermania reported a glittering opening night for his solo show Every Brilliant Thing at the Hudson Theatre, where A-listers like Lupita Nyongo, Lea DeLaria, Steve Buscemi, Daniel Dae Kim, and Jane Krakowski turned out in force to cheer on the Tony winner in this intimate tale of hope amid depression. Playbill confirms the production, which officially opened March 12 after previews starting February 21, is packing houses with grosses topping a million dollars last week, running through late May with shows tonight at 5 and 8:30 pm. NY Stage Review raves that Radcliffe works the nearly thousand-seat venue like a living room charmer, handing out list entries to audience members, ad-libbing hilariously, and even sparking a disco ball dance party to Curtis Mayfields Move On Upall in a 70-minute heart-tugger about compiling every brilliant thing worth living for, from ice cream to water fights.
